Two explosions outside Hamid Karzai International Airport in Kabul, Afghanistan, left a site of slaughter and destruction on Thursday that killed at least 13 US soldiers and an unknown number of Afghan civilians.
The attacks were believed to have been carried out by suicide bombers and armed men from ISIS, US officials said, adding that they were still working on “calculating the total loss”. The attacks only added to the chaos, panic and fear at the airport; Many Afghan families have been fighting since the Taliban came to power from Afghanistan. Pictures showed rescue workers and civilians rushing to help those injured by the explosions and gunfire.
